Things are changing in the Barcelona camp. For a year now, the Spanish side has wanted to sign Griezmann, but now he will have to wait in line.
The priority, according to 'AS', is the arrival of De Ligt. Barcelona want to bolster their defence and have been working for a while on the possible signing of the Ajax man.
Barcelona have already sealed the deal with De Jong, one of De Ligt's teammates from Ajax. And it seems as though they are not forgetting about their other Dutch target.
So, De Ligt's name looks to be marked in red on Barca's agenda. Griezmann will have to wait...
'AS' has said that the fact that Griezmann had said no to the Catalan club last summer, has caused disappointment. Now they are not so sure of his arrival at the Camp Nou as they were last summer.
This is not the only thing that has caused doubt surrounding Griezmann's signing. His salary is another big factor. At Atletico, Griezmann earns 23 million euros per season, a figure which Barcelona are not prepared to offer him.
Antoine Griezmann is no longer one of Barcelona's priorities, according to 'AS'. A year ago he made the decision that he would not feel right at the Catalan club and, now, other footballers have taken his place as top priority on the right.
The favoured forward to reinforce Barca's front line would be Jovic. But we will have to see what happens next summer. If Griezmann wants to sign for Barca, he will have to work to reconvince the Catalan club.
